How to untangle alcohol from your identity

Join Paula Williams, Awarded Trauma-Informed Therapist, for a virtual workshop all about untangling alcohol from your identity. In this session, Paula will explore why alcohol can become more than just a habit and what it may be regulating beneath the surface. Together, you’ll gently unpack the deeper emotional layers that shape our relationship with drinking and discover compassionate, trauma-informed approaches to change.

In this workshop, Paula will cover the following key topics:

  • Why alcohol becomes more than a habit and what it may be regulating beneath the surface
  • How stress, trauma and high-functioning pressure shape our relationship with drinking
  • The emotional layers, including shame and loss, that often keep patterns in place
  • Trauma-informed pathways to change that go beyond willpower and focus on safety and self-understanding
